Plate tectonics explains
Yuri [45]

Answer:

From the deepest ocean trench to the tallest mountain, plate tectonics explains the features and movement of Earth's surface in the present and the past. Plate tectonics is the theory that Earth's outer shell is divided into several plates that glide over the mantle, the rocky inner layer above the core.

What happens to the body when motor neurons are injured?
NikAS [45]

The correct answer is option B

A motor neuron is a neuron which consists of a cell body and axon. Cell body lies in the motor cortex, spinal cord or brainstem and axon projects outside the spinal cord or inside the spinal cord which directly or indirectly controls the function of muscles or glands.

The functions associated with the movement of muscles or glands are directly affected by the injured motor neurons.
